DQ3: Sector Erase Timer
After writing a sector erase command sequence, the system may read DQ3 to determine
whether or not erasure has begun. (The sector erase timer does not apply to the chip erase
command.) If additional sectors are selected for erasure, the entire time-out also applies after
each additional sector erase command. When the time-out period is complete, DQ3 switches
from a
0
to a
1.
If the time between additional sector erase commands from the system can
be assumed to be less than 50 µs, the system need not monitor DQ3. See also
After the sector erase command is written, the system should read the status of DQ7 (Data#
Polling) or DQ6 (Toggle Bit I) to ensure that the device has accepted the command sequence,
and then read DQ3. If DQ3 is
1,
the Embedded Erase algorithm has begun; all further com-
mands (except Erase Suspend) are ignored until the erase operation is complete. If DQ3 is
0,
the device accepts additional sector erase commands. To ensure the command is accepted,
the system software should check the status of DQ3 prior to and following each subsequent
sector erase command. If DQ3 is high on the second status check, the last command might
not have been accepted.
shows the status of DQ3 relative to the other status bits.
DQ1: Write-to-Buffer Abort
DQ1 indicates whether a Write-to-Buffer operation was aborted. Under these conditions DQ1
produces a
1.
The system must issue the Write-to-Buffer-Abort-Reset command sequence to
return the device to reading array data. See
for more details.
